I don't know the answer to your question, but I do know that there are often threads on Fodor's from people who have been hit with traffic fines for driving into prohibited areas in Florence. So be VERY careful. I would contact the hotel and ask them for very specific instructions. Otherwise, if it's an option, I would suggest returning the car in Florence and then hire another one as you leave. BTW the fines are hefty - in the hundreds of dollars.
